What are some of the best uses of beef or chicken broth? I've been cooking my oats in it and wondering what other applications it could have aside from soup.
great to deglaze pans after searing meat or adding to a stirfry if it's cooking too hot. I also like to make stew with beeth broth out of stewing beef or oxtail or both! easy with carrots, potatoes and onions yum yum, don't forget paprika!!
>>7286361
Soups, stews, sauces, chili, deglazing a pan, cooking vegetables, poaching liquid for meats or fish, etc. the uses are countless.
